WhiteHat Arsenal possesses a powerful suite of GUI-Browser based web
security tools. These endowments make WhiteHat Arsenal capable of
completing painstaking web security penetration test work faster and
more effectively than any tool currently available. Imagine having the
ability to quickly customize and execute just about any web security
attack, and having those penetration attempts logged in XML format for
later reporting or analysis.
WhiteHat Arsenal makes it possible to quickly focus attention on HTML
forms, to easily view their inputs, (even the hidden fields), and modify
them in seconds. It can be utilized to rapidly uncover a vast a number
of vulnerabilities in any web application by providing the ability to
perform any of the following attacks faster than ever before:
Perform the following attacks:
Cross-Site Scripting (XSS)
Parameter Tampering
Cookie Poisoning
URL Manipulation
CGI Directory Traversal
Direct OS Commanding
Meta Character Injection
SQL Command Injection
HTTP Request Header Manipulation
HTTP Request Method Manipulation
Protocol Manipulation
and many more variants and combinations...

WhiteHat Arsenal Features
Session Manager:
WhiteHat Arsenal logs all HTTP Request activities in either XML or HTML
format. This allows for the presentation of log data to be easier to
understand, analyze and report on. The Session Manager keeps log files
organized with an easy to use Session Management system. Create, Edit,
Delete sessions as well as individual log files. Session Manager makes
web security easier by allowing organization of multiple independent
tasks.
Spidering:
- Page Characteristics Logging XML Logging
- Web Application Description XML Logging
- Session Based
- Spider Continuation
- Results Limiter
- Image Counter
*Full HTTP Support
*Enhanced Features
Ripper:
- Allows on-the-fly editing of HTML Forms.
- Request/Response header viewing and editing.
- Request/Response Display HTTP Headers ON|OFF Support
- Advanced control over HTTP requests.
- HTTP Request XML Logging
- Session Based
- 302/301 Support w/ Auto Interface Update
- WH HTML Proxy
*Full HTTP Support
*Enhanced Features
Forced Browsing:
Find hidden directories, log files, and backup files which may contain
useful information quickly, easily and efficiently.
- Common Directory forcing
- Common Logfile Forcing
- Backup file suffix forcing
- Session Based
- Response String Searching Support
*Full HTTP Support
Utilities:
Quickly encode or decode strings, authentication credentials or anything
else, to reverse engineer applications, perform various discovery
methodologies, or pervasive attacks.
- URL Encode/Decode
- Base64 Encode/Decode
- ROT13
- MD4
- MD5
- SHA-1
*Full HTTP Support
(Ability to modify and manipulate just about every aspect of an HTTP
Request.)
- Path
- Protocol
- Port
- Content
- Method
- Version
- Web Auth
- Request Headers
- HTTP Fixup Feature
- Browser Mimic
Enhanced Features:
- Easy to use Web-GUI Interface.
(Only a recent web browser is required to use everything in WhiteHat
Arsenal.)
- Browser Mimicking
(Mimic the HTTP Request behavior of a standard web browser.)
- WH Proxy
(Remain within WhiteHat Arsenal, having the ability to traverse web
sites while
modifying HTTP requests).
Support:
- Web Authentication
- SSL
